Changing a route
During destination guidance, you can revise the
navigation system's route recommendations to
avoid particular stretches of road. Enter the
number of miles/kilometers that you want to
travel before returning to the original route.
1.
Select "Navigation" and press the control-
ler.
2.
Move the highlight marker to the third field
from the top. Turn the controller until "New
route" is selected and press the controller.
3.
Turn the controller to enter the desired
number and press the controller.
The route is recalculated.
To exit from the menu without changing the
route:
Select the
arrow and press the controller.
Traffic information*
In many metropolitan areas you can receive
traffic information broadcast by radio stations.
The traffic conditions are monitored by traffic
control centers and the traffic information is
updated periodically.
During destination guidance, the traffic infor-
mation relevant to the route you are planning to
take is automatically shown or, if desired, taken
into account in route planning. Whether desti-
nation guidance is active or not, you can have
the traffic information displayed in the map view
or in the traffic info list.
